Weighing In

In Power Drive this week the team is working on the chassis. The team also held concession stands again for the high school basketball games. The weight of the prototype was also calibrated. The team used a digital go-cart scale to find the correct percentages of weight in the front and rear of the car. This scale was donated by one of our many sponsors Rick Logeman and River Rat Racing.

Working Hard

The team is still hard at work. They are currently working on the chassis for the new car. M. Wellman and R. Mohl have finished the nose piece to the car and are starting on a new piece to the car. The construction of the nose piece took a variety of tools. One of the tools used was the tubing bender. With the tubing bender the team is able to make precise angles and radiuses on certain pieces. Another tool used was the tubing notcher. The tubing notcher is used to place an opening in a tube to allow pieces to fit together. Also this week the team is working on the documentation video.
